First Impressions

Vista Park feels like a straightforward North Charleston neighborhood with an unpretentious, established look. The homes here date to the late 1960s and early 1970s, and that gives the streets a consistent, lived-in character rather than a polished new-build feel. Recent remarks point to renovation potential and move-in-ready updates side by side, so the community can read as both practical and adaptable depending on the property.

Home Styles & Community Feel

Single-family ranch homes define the landscape, with modest lot sizes that keep the setting manageable and easy to maintain. Many homes have been updated over time, with mentions of new roofs, newer HVAC systems, fresh paint, luxury vinyl plank flooring, and screened porches. That mix of original construction and selective renovation gives Vista Park a grounded, working-neighborhood feel, where curb appeal often comes from simple landscaping, clean lines, and functional layouts rather than elaborate extras.

The price point sits well below many surrounding Charleston-area markets, which adds to the neighborhood’s appeal for buyers looking for a practical home base. With no basements, garages, or pools showing up in the community profile, the emphasis stays on the house itself, the lot, and the location.

Location & Schools

Vista Park sits in a well-connected part of North Charleston, with the city’s major travel routes close at hand. Public remarks specifically call out I-26 and I-526, along with access to downtown Charleston and other key destinations across the Lowcountry. Park Circle is an easy nearby reference point for shopping and dining, and the community also benefits from proximity to Charleston International Airport, Boeing, Bosch, Mercedes-Benz Vans, Joint Base Charleston, Trident Technical College, and the Port of Charleston.

School assignments tied to the neighborhood are Pinehurst Elementary, Northwoods Middle, and Stall High.
